In this paper,using 2-Hydroxy-benzaldehyde,N1-[2-(2-Amino-vinylamino)-vinyl]-ethene-1, 2-diamine(L1),1,10-phenanthroline as the basic ligand,seven novel coordination compounds,containing Zn(Ⅱ),Ni(Ⅱ),Pb(Ⅱ)and Cd(Ⅱ),respectively,were prepared.All the compounds were characterized by IR and element analyses.The crystal structures of these compounds were determined by X-ray single crystal diffraction method.Futhermore,the interaction of the compounds with DNA,and the action of them on Tetrahymena thermophila growth metabolism were also studied.The main research in this paper are as included:1.Four compounds containing phen ligand have been synthesized and one of they is the compound of reduced Schiff base ligand.They are[Zn(sglyl)(phen)]·7H2O(1); [Cd(phen)2(Ac)]ClO4·H2O(2);Zn(phen)2Cl2(3);[Zn(phen)2(C5H7O2)]ClO4(4).The central metal atom in compounds 2,3 and 4 have a distorted octahedronal coordination geometry.Zn(Ⅱ)in compound 1 is coordinated through a phen and a reduced Schiff base ligand with a distorted triangle bipyramid coordination geometry.It is intersting that compound 1 has a 3D network structure with opening holes,and every hole was fillfulled with an infinite water cluster.2.Two ligands L1 and L2 and three compounds have been synthesized.They are [Zn2L1(Ac)]2·2H2O(5);[Ni)2L1(salicyl)]·H2O·CH3OH(6);[Pb2L3(NO3)(CH2N(CH3)2)]n(7). It is to be the flexile character of the L1 ligand,the coordination modes of three compounds are different.Compounds 5 and 6 are binuclear complex with five and six coordinated central metal,respectively;and 7 is a metal coordination polymer with seven coordinated central metal.3.The characteristics of the interaction of the compounds with DNA were examined by Ultra-Vis absorption spectra,EB-fluorescent spectra,viscosity measurements.The results show that the major type of interaction between compounds 1-4 might be partial intercalative binding mode.And for compounds 5-7,the interaction mode of one compoud with DNA is greatly different from those of the others.4.The action of the seven compounds on Tetrahymena thermophila growth metabolism was studied by microcalorimetry.The result means that the Zn(Ⅱ)and Ni(Ⅱ) compounds may promote Tetrahymena thermophila's growth;and the Pb(Ⅱ),Cd(Ⅱ) compounds may inhibit Tetrahymena thermophila'a growth,especially for the Pb(Ⅱ) compound,in our experimentative concentration.
